Forensics tent set up outside Folkestone College as pavement cordoned off

A white forensics tent has been set up outside a college following a medical incident.

Police have cordoned off the pavement in front of Folkestone College in Shorncliffe Road.

One police car is currently at the scene, with an officer manning the cordon.

The road remains open to traffic, but police have taped off a large section of the pavement.

One resident living nearby said they saw “flashing blue lights” at about 6am as police responded to the incident.

A spokesman for the force confirmed that officers were at the scene of a medical incident.

The ambulance service has been contacted for further information.
